Steve Moon’s Reviews > Animal Farm / 1984 > Status Update


flag

Steve’s Previous Updates

Steve Moon
Steve Moon is on page 50 of 400
Jan 30, 2026 05:03PM
Animal Farm / 1984


No comments have been added yet.